Solution Files

Solutions to the coding challenges are included with this activity.

Do not look at the completed code solutions, before you've evaluated the screen shots and tried to interpret the CSS. Once you've evaluated the design an styling, use the solution files to compare and contrast with your own work.

Note the structure of the solution code. Try to evaluate the ways your decisions differ from the solution code.

Resources

The resources folder contains files designed to help you complete the activity. This will include screen shots of the completed HTML and files containing the text.

Screen Shots

Screen shot of the final code are provided for reference. Feel free to compare your rendered code with the screen shots as you work to try and determine if you are on track.

  • index_no_css.png is a screen shot the rendered HTML before any CSS has been applied.

  • index.png is a screen shot of the rendered HTML after it has been styled with CSS.
